Output e28ab9358dfa2bffcb657507808150be17c47f0634db348b0ef7679b91738e14:3

value
38210000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db2b3686ee5a15e2270ac4ca95bc0f20f14e2dea OP_EQUALVERIFY OP_CHECKSIG
address
LfCp1iTCWAbHYvswnbD84tcbzpXU3DDeX7
transaction
e28ab9358dfa2bffcb657507808150be17c47f0634db348b0ef7679b91738e14
spent
true